- The distance between New Orleans Audubon, La, Usa and Veraval, India is approximately 13,978 km or 8,686 mi.
- To reach New Orleans Audubon, La in this distance one would set out from Veraval bearing 339°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ach New Orleans Audubon, La bearing 202.7° or SSW .
- New Orleans Audubon, La has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Veraval has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- The average annual temperature is 5.4 °C (9.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.8 °C (15.8°F) more in New Orleans Audubon, La.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 822.8 mm (32.4 in) more which is equivalent to 822.8 l/m² (20.19 US gal/ft²) or 8,228,000 l/ha (879,628 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.5° lower in New Orleans Audubon, La than in Veraval.
